

One School Global — Clearing the Way for Education
Quantum Group is delivering a staged transformation at One School Global:
demolition and brickwork packages are complete and the project is live as detailed civil engineering works continue. Our role has been deliberately phased — starting with a meticulous soft strip, followed by targeted dismantling and structural modification, finished brickwork to secure new openings and now the complex drainage and service runs that will future‑proof the site. Soft Strip Out — Clearing the canvas for change
Where do you start when you need a blank slate? We began with a full soft strip to prepare the building for every subsequent trade. All carpet tiles were carefully removed, floor panels lifted to expose and extract underfloor electrical cabling and ceiling‑mounted mechanical and electrical systems — including HVAC components and their containment — were safely disconnected and taken out. Plasterboard stud walls were stripped back, while doors and doorframes were removed. In both plant rooms we decommissioned and removed mechanical pipework with careful isolation, labelling and segregation for client approval.
Dismantling & Deconstruction — Precision Where It Counts
How do you remove heavy internal fabric without destabilising the rest of the building? Our dismantling and deconstruction scope at One School Global focused on selective removal to create functional, reconfigured spaces. Internal block walls were dismantled to open up the new bathroom areas, and an internal partition separating the downstairs plant room from the main area was carefully taken out to create a generous, unobstructed space. We also removed the glazed front entrance canopy — a complex sequence of safe dismantling that required temporary works and lift planning. To accommodate new ventilation plant, our teams cut 28 openings through brick and block on both sides of the building, accurately sized and positioned to the client’s mechanical design. Every cut and removal was planned with temporary support, dust control and access management in mind, ensuring adjacent finishes and services remained protected.

Brickwork & Structural Openings — Strength and Finish
When openings are required, how do you combine structural integrity with a neat finish? For each of the 28 new apertures we installed certified steel lintels sized to the loading conditions, ensuring long‑term structural performance. Once lintels were bedded and tied into the existing masonry, our bricklayers infilled the head courses above and reinstated the exposed brickwork to match the existing façade where required.
Why is the civil phase critical?
How do you take a finished site back to base level, chase services into a building and run them neatly through a busy courtyard without bringing the programme to a halt? At One School Global the civil engineering package is the live, critical path work: breaking out existing concrete, excavating service trenches, installing new drainage from the mains, routing pipework into the building and across the courtyard — all executed with precision to protect the programme and the client’s operational needs.
